Sober Time

What’s your sobriety goal? Are you struggling with one addiction that’s turning your life upside down, or do you struggle with an addiction to more than one substance? Either way, the Sober Time app’s primary feature is to track your goals toward sobriety, and you can even log multiple substance abuse journeys separately.

Sometimes working on yourself and focusing on one goal at a time works; other times, multitasking is best. Regardless of your approach, remember that Rome wasn’t built in a day! Moving forward is winning, no matter how small the steps may be. The Sober Time app even has built-in goals allowing you to see your progress.

Key Feature: Precise Real-Time Tracker

What’s a precise real-time tracker? It’s a sobriety counter that’s as unique as each person who uses it. Customize your display mode on the app by choosing heartbeats, seconds, days, or any other metric that motivates you and keeps you focused on your goal.

If it inspires you to see your sobriety progress in literally seconds, you can opt for this mode in the real-time tracker. If that type of micro-measurement feels overwhelming, you can simply track days. The good news is you can experiment and try multiple tracking modes to see which is effective.

Do you love data? The Sober Time app tracks statistics for you. Detailed stats on your progress and journey provide a dashboard to visualize how you’re doing and help identify behavior patterns to create self-awareness. Keep in mind that this data is only as good as your tracking. You must diligently track your wins, setbacks, and goals to get data that’s accurate and helpful.

Nomo

Have you ever been at the point with substance abuse when you want to shout, “No More!” That’s the origin of the sobriety app, Nomo. The app tagline is, “It’s time to say no more.”

This app started as a personal project, and it’s all about tracking using clocks. This simple app focuses on tracking progress, but you can tap into other features depending on your needs.

With refocus tools that give your mind healthy distractions, such as games or other exercises, Nomo provides ways to resist impulses to use, repeat mistakes, or relapse. From simple breathing exercises to virtual bubble wrap, Nomo offers tools for returning focus to the goals you’ve set out to accomplish with sobriety.

Other features include an encouragement wall where you can leave messages for others

Also, for those who find journaling helpful, there’s a way to journal your thoughts, disappointments, wins, or reflections. If journaling is your thing, you can type your thoughts in a convenient app in your pocket.

Key Feature: Customizable Clocks

The app’s main feature is clocking time. There are multiple ways to clock progress. You can even have multiple clocks for multiple bad habits or addictions you’re trying to break.

Interested to see milestones? It will show you on the clock. Does seeing your winning streak motivate you? It’s all in the clock. Do you need to stay accountable for check-ins? The app offers a timestamp check-in tracking feature.

The app allows you to set up unlimited clocks, then customize them to your liking. You can name the clock, make it your favorite color, and put it in a category if you wish. If you have a setback and feel like you need to start over, you can always add a new clock. Share the clock with friends, partners, or your therapist — or don’t. You have the option to keep all of your clocks private. Say “no more” to substance abuse, but accomplish it your way.
